Olaf Hartig and his #research team have a vision that we should be able to bring together information that is currently scattered across the Web by integrating the info virtually so that each player retains control over their own information #KAW100

The paper “Ontology Generation Using Large Language Models” shows how LLMs can support ontology engineering, outperforming novice modellers with the right prompts!
This work is supported by HACID, further contributing to hybrid collective intelligence.
